Overview

Isle of Arrows is a unique strategy game that combines the mechanics of board games with tower defense elements. Players must strategically place randomly generated tiles to construct defenses on an expanding island terrain. The roguelike structure ensures each playthrough is different, with varying tiles, enemies, rewards, and events. This innovative blend creates a fresh take on traditional tower defense gameplay.

The game offers multiple modes including Campaign, Gauntlet, and Daily Defense, along with various modifiers and challenges that enhance replayability. With over 70 tiles and 75 bonus cards, players can build diverse defensive structures while managing resources to fend off waves of enemies. Suitable for fans of strategic puzzles and tower defense games, Isle of Arrows provides deep tactical gameplay and hours of entertainment.

Features

Isle of Arrows stands out with its innovative tile-placement mechanic that adds a strategic layer to the classic tower defense genre. Players draw random tiles each round, deciding whether to place them immediately or spend coins to skip to the next one. This system includes towers for attacking, roads for extending enemy paths, flags for expanding the island, gardens for generating coins, and taverns for boosting adjacent towers.

The game features three distinct modes - Campaign, Gauntlet, and Daily Defense - each offering unique challenges. Additionally, there are over 70 different tiles, more than 75 bonus cards, and 10+ events that can either assist or hinder progress. These features, combined with the roguelike structure where every run is randomly generated, ensure that no two playthroughs are ever the same, providing endless strategic possibilities and keeping players engaged.
